Microsoft Rebrands Xbox to XBOX Amid Fan Controversy

Microsoft is transitioning the branding of its gaming ecosystem to XBOX, utilizing all capital letters. The shift follows a direct engagement effort with the community on the social platform X, where Xbox CEO Asha Sharma conducted a poll asking users to choose between the standard Xbox casing and the all-caps XBOX version.

Following the results of the poll, which favored the all-caps version, Microsoft updated its X account to reflect the new XBOX branding. When asked for comment on the change, Microsoft referred inquiries back to the post shared by Sharma.

The update to XBOX is part of a broader strategic shift described by Sharma as a return of Xbox. This initiative includes several fan-focused updates to consoles, a new company logo, and adjustments to Game Pass pricing.

Organizational and Structural Changes

The rebranding follows a series of organizational changes led by Sharma. A few weeks prior to May 15, 2026, Sharma eliminated the name Microsoft Gaming and restored the name of the company’s gaming division to Xbox.

In the week preceding May 15, 2026, Sharma detailed further organizational shifts specifically targeting the Xbox platform team. This reorganization is intended to streamline how the company develops its gaming infrastructure.

In addition to the structural changes and rebranding, Sharma recently introduced a new boot-up animation for the Xbox hardware as part of the effort to refresh the user experience.

Historical Branding Context

While the shift to XBOX may seem like a new experiment, it represents a return to the brand’s original visual identity. The first Xbox console featured an all-caps logo, and Microsoft has historically used capitalized versions for the logos of the Xbox 360, Xbox One, and the Xbox Series X and S consoles.

The current transition to all-caps across digital branding aligns the company’s social presence with these established hardware identifiers.

Implementation Status

The rollout of the new branding appears to be incremental. As of May 15, 2026, the change has been implemented on the company’s X account, but the official Xbox accounts on Bluesky and Threads have not yet been renamed.

The move to XBOX suggests a pivot toward a more community-driven approach to brand management, utilizing real-time feedback from the user base to determine the visual direction of the platform.
